In an independent-measures experiment with three treatment conditions, all three treatments have the same mean, m 1 = m 2 = m 3. for these data ss between equals ____.

Respuesta :

As in an independent-measures experiment with three treatment conditions, according to ANOVA, all three treatments have the same mean, m 1 = m 2 = m 3, and the value for SS between treatments is 0.

What is ANOVA?

An analytical technique for analyzing variance (ANOVA) is used to look at mean differences. It is made up of many statistical models and the corresponding estimation methods (such as the "variation" within and between groups).
